When Marlon Brando declined to return for the prequel elements of The Godfather Part II , Coppola faced the impossible task of portraying a young Vito Corleone. The studio pressured him to hire an established star, but Coppola remembered a brilliant, unused screen test from an unknown actor named Robert De Niro .
